To perform user calibration

Perform user-calibration:
• Every two years or after 4000 hours of operation.
• If the ambient temperature is >10° C from the calibration temperature.
• If you want to maximize the measurement accuracy.
The amount of use, environmental conditions, and experience with other
instruments help determine if you need shorter User Cal intervals.
User Cal performs an internal self-alignment routine to optimize the signal path in
the oscilloscope. The routine uses internally generated signals to optimize circuits
that affect channel sensitivity, offset, and trigger parameters.
Performing User Cal will invalidate your Certificate of Calibration. If NIST (National
Institute of Standards and Technology) traceability is required, perform the
"Performance Verification" procedure in the Keysight InfiniiVision
2000/3000 X-Series Oscilloscopes Service Guide using traceable sources.

To perform user calibration:

1 Disconnect all inputs from the front and rear panels, including the digital
2 Press the rear-panel CAL button to disable calibration protection.
3 Connect short (12 inch maximum) equal length cables to each analog channel's
Keysight InfiniiVision 2000 X-Series Oscilloscopes User's Guide
channels cable on an MSO, and allow the oscilloscope to warm up before
performing this procedure.
BNC connector on the front of the oscilloscope. You will need two equal-length
cables for a 2-channel oscilloscope or four equal-length cables for a 4-channel
oscilloscope.
Use 50W RG58AU or equivalent BNC cables when performing User Cal.
For a 2-channel oscilloscope, connect a BNC tee to the equal length cables.
Then connect a BNC(f)-to-BNC(f) (also called a barrel connector) to the tee as
shown below.
